Elmo Cake Pops
Elmo nose are simply orange jelly beans. Elmo's mouth is made of candy background cut in two, and his eyes are drawn with a pen in edible ink.
Red Candy Coating
To decorate these characters, dip in candy colored first coating.
Elmo in progress
Although the coating is wet, tie the mouth and eyes and let dry. When the attachments are dry, you can use a toothpick to water the coating more.
Let me stop here and tell you. That takes time. I wanted them to have all the effect of a fur coat, but you can certainly try another method to speed things up. For example, they may simply be smooth and you can pipe to the mouth with black candy writers or draw with a pen edible ink.
Elmo in progress
But I took the long way since it was a special occasion. You will need to drizzle, dab, and the point in the cake pop. Or at least on the whole front of the pop. I will not tell. Make sure the layer of the coating around the mouth. You will need to build a base on the edges to make it look more realistic and less stuck on.
Cookie Monster Cake Pops
Use the same technique to Cookie Monster. His mouth is bigger than Elmo so I tried to make a lip this time with the melting of the candy.
Oscar the Grouch Cake Pops
Oscar. Oscar talk. After the first two characters, I'm not completely satisfied with the mouth, so I tried a different technique with the Grouch and I think he liked it. Instead of a candy melting attached to the front, cut the candy melt in half and use the two pieces to form an open mouth. This is a little more difficult because you have to remodel the pretty cake balls in a C-shape (if you were to look sideways). This is the mouth has a place to sit. If you try to do the mouth outside of football, it will not be right. Hope that makes sense. Do not forget to set up the green around the mouth so that it seems transparent. Again ... this is work.
Also, Oscar's eyes are different than others. His are inlaid instead of staying on top of pop. To get the look, cut the candy pieces in half and tie. Once dry, use a writer brown candy or candy coating chocolate and tips on eyebrow. His tongue is a red heart jumbo sprinkle with the tip and rounded cutting.

Big Bird Cake Pops
I must say, when I started doing this, I do not know how I could get this big guy. First, I thought the yellow sugar beads or mini m & ms yellow, but none of them looked right for their feathers. So I used the sanding sugar sprinkled on top after drizzling to make it look cozy. His eyelids are decorated with pink and blue edible ink pen. Its bill is candy corn with the cut end to make it easier to attach.
Candy Coating
Dip candy corn in yellow candy melts. But only if the candy coating is thin and fluid like this. In addition, this coating is Merckens and added nothing to make this thin. It was heated in the microwave on med-low 30 second intervals and stirring between. But if your coating is too thick, you can add some primordial crystal, shortening or vegetable oil to help lighten it. And if that is not small, so do not try to dip candy corn because it will be just a big glob and not enough on Big Bird.
Beaks
Some beaks. Let them dry on waxed paper. Or just ignore all that and give Big Bird beak orange candy corn not.
